Nurse Practitioner (NP): Good morning Marnie! So tell me, how are you feeling now?
Marnie (M): The pain in my foot is unbearable! I was exercising and a weight slipped on my
foot.
NP: I can’t imagine what you must be feeling right now. But tell me, the last time we met, we
discussed on your medication about your depression and your participation in an exercise
rehabilitation plan. Would you mind sharing your experiences on it? How do you feel?
M: Well, I have tried to stick to my medications and my mum keeps on reminding me to take
them. But the medications make my mouth so dry and there are days when I just can’t seem to
make it out of bed. The exercise plan seemed enjoyable but right now, I don’t really think I can
make my way out of anything with this pain. It feels miserable, like I am back to where I started.
NP: My apologies Marnie, but I would point out that you are doing a great job and your efforts
to stick to your medication and rehabilitation is a reflection of your wonderful progress. Now for
your pain, you have been prescribed a medication named Oxycodone. It is a liquid medication
which is used to reduce symptoms of pain by you can say, changing the way your body reacts to
these symptoms (Lee et al., 2018). Since your general practitioner has already prescribed you
with the dosages, I am sure following the same will give you some relief from your pain. As a
precaution however, you must strictly make sure that you are measuring the medication with the
spoon provided with the solution because too much of it could be harmful (Lelic et al., 2016).
M: Harmful? Would it make my mouth dry again? I already feel so tired to do anything!
NP: That is a great point you highlighted Marnie, and was just about getting to it. Relax – very
few patients have reported any harmful side effects with this medication – unless of course they
are overdosing on it, which is easy to avoid if you are careful. Perhaps we can talk with your

2MEDICATION PRESCRIPTION: TRANSCRIPT
mum and together, we can make sure you stick to the measurements and amounts, right? So
regarding the case with dry mouth – yes, this medication can make your mouth feel a little dry
and also make you feel a little light headed (Riley et al., 2015). Tell me Marnie, you enjoy
drinking tea very often?
M: Oh yes, I do!
NP: I understand Marnie. But did you know that tea often leaves a bitter, dry after taste in your
mouth – so when you are consuming too much of it, it often makes your mouth feel drier than it
already is (Tran et al., 2017). Tell me one more thing, if you don’t mind, how are you dealing
with your smoking?
M: Well after my last visit with the counselor, I have cut down quite a bit.
NP: It is okay Marnie, you are doing great! But I would also point that smoking has a tendency
to dry your mouth too. So I suppose if you could gradually cut down on your tea and smoking, I
am sure it would help lessen the effects of dryness of oxycodone! And remember to take sips of
water throughout the day, I am sure that will help to get rid of the dryness! (Åstrøm et al., 2019).
Now coming to the part on dizziness, this medication can make you feel a little light headed after
consumption. So I would suggest that you rest sometime after taking it and move up from bed
very slowly and gradually. You will anyway need to be at complete rest for your injury (Spiegel
et al., 2018).
